Position Type: Admin Professional Technical/Systems Administrator Date Posted: 4/18/2025 Location: Education Service Center Date Available: 07/01/2025 Closing Date: 04/25/2025 Position Purpose: The Systems Administrator is responsible for ensuring the optimal performance, security, and reliability of the District‘s information technology systems, equipment, and infrastructure. This role requires a combination of technical expertise, problem-solving skills, and excellent communication skills. The successful candidate will work with a team of IT professionals to provide high-quality IT services to the school district. Essential Duties : • Install, support and maintain enterprise data center equipment • Administer enterprise virtualization environments • Configure, manage & maintain Google Workspace environments • Monitor, analyze and optimize various systems for use by applications, databases and utilities • Manage and support enterprise backup and recovery systems • Administration of external SAN and/or NAS storage • Perform software and hardware patching, updating and deployments • Collaborate with Network, Application, Database and Server teams to implement solutions and resolve issues • Manage Papercut Print Server and provide system troubleshooting • Develop and maintain implementation plans, test plans, procedures, system administrator guides and other documentation as required • Ensures the highest level of infrastructure availability and performance • Conduct high-level root-cause analysis for service interruption and establish preventive measures • Perform other duties as assigned or requested Education/Certification: • Bachelor‘s Degree or higher in a technology field or comparable progressive experience, preferably in Systems Administration role • Relevant Professional/Technical Certifications (AWS, Microsoft, Google, etc.) Experience: • 5+ years Systems Administration with an emphasis with Windows platforms, VMware virtualization and storage/backups • Prefer experience in cloud infrastructure (i.e. AWS) and Google Workspace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ities: • Expert knowledge of Microsoft server platform and technologies • Professional experience installing, supporting, and maintaining enterprise servers • Strong experience with server virtualization (VMware / Hyper-V, etc.) • Experience deploying and managing multiple server services: Active Directory, Group Policies, DNS, DHCP, RADIUS, IIS, Centralized Antivirus programs • Strong experience with Microsoft Active Directory and SCCM. • Strong experience with authentication protocols such as LDAP and SAML • Experience in applying cyber security hardening configurations to virtualization platforms, server operating systems, and core server technologies including Active Directory, DNS, and DHCP • Experience with cloud technologies including IaaS, SaaS, PaaS, and DaaS • Experience with Google Workspace, Google Cloud & Chrome OS policies • Good understanding of networking essentials and communication protocols (TCP/IP, SNMP, SMTP) • Experience with Cisco UCS and HP/Nimble hardware preferred • Ability to analyze complex technical environments, determine needs, towards proposing and executing timely and effective solutions. • Knowledge of and applicable experience with ITIL practices • Plan and organize workload, as well as accomplish tasks with minimum supervision • Stay current with IT trends and new technologies • Able to respond and resolve urgent calls for emergencies Salary Range: minimum $70,642 to midpoint $93,214 253 contract days
